Our B & B in BrooklynBrooklyn is a rural village in the quiet, north-eastern corner of Connecticut, an area renowned for fine dining, art galleries, museums, vineyards, hiking and biking trails.  About 45 minutes from the maritime museum at Mystic Seaport, 3 hours from New York, 1 hour from Newport, Rhode Island, and about 75 minutes from Boston.  A delightful recently renovated 18th century, Colonial style country house, situated on 12 wooded acres divided up by dry stone walls and picket fences.  All the comforts of home are here, it is authentic and simply decorated with antiques, polished hardwood floors and rugs.  This old house has quite a history, it was once a stop on the underground railroad for escaped slaves and a local abolitionist was married in the front parlour in 1834.  The owners are local enthusiasts and will happily guide you to nearby scenic haunts.
